Important
Following re-assembly, tap operation should be
checked at all settings. Ensure that red spot on knob
indicates correct position. (i.e. Check that spindle
adaptor has been replaced in correct position.)
3.8 GOVERNOR (NATURAL GAS ONLY)
This component is maintenance free. Check that blue
dust cap for vent is fitted and in good condition.
This protects the breather hole.
3.9 TO CLEAN BALL VALVE
Turn OFF mains water supply and drain steamer tank
at draw off tap.
Remove cistern lid.
Remove split pin from valve body.
Raise ball valve arm slightly and withdraw from valve
socket .
Unscrew cap at valve end and extract valve plug.
Clean all components with a soft rag. DO NOT USE
ABRASIVES.
Replace in reverse order and test soundness. Flush
out pipes to steaming oven and re-fit the tank.
3.10 ADJUSTING DOOR FIT
Prise off hinge covers with a plain screwdriver.
Shut door and assess if seal leaks or if hinge binding
is present.
Undo screws which secure hinges to door.
The serration in the hinges allows door to be adjusted
in or out to take up slack or prevent hinge bind.
The catch adjustment is accomodated by adding or
removing shims as appropriate.
3.11 IGNITION SYSTEM FAULTS
a) If spark igniter does not light pilot, check for a spark
and gas. If no spark is evident inspect electrode to
ensure the ceramic is not cracked and that igniter
lead is correctly located. Check insulation on lead
for damage also. Use an insulated screwdriver to
form a spark gap and check igniter operation (see
Figure 3).
Having established a spark, check gas flow to pilot
by lighting with a taper. If there is no gas, inspect
that pilot injector is not blocked. Carry out check
detailed in Section 2.5.3 of this document.
b) If spark ignites pilot but goes out when knob is
released, ensure FFD thermocouple connections
are tight and that pilot end of thermocouple is
enveloped in flame. If this does not result in
establishing pilot then replace thermocouple.
If there is still a fault then the gas valve will have
to replaced. See Section 3.8 for procedure.

SECTION 4 - SPARES
When ordering spare parts, always quote appliance
type and serial number. This information will be found
on data plate attached to unit base.
